The Price at the Pump: Factors Affecting Petrol Costs

Determining the cost at the pump is a difficult puzzle, influenced by a range of factors. Crude oil prices, regularly considered the most significant factor, fluctuate based on global supply and demand. Geopolitical events, natural disasters, and economic trends can all influence crude oil prices, resulting in changes at the pump. Refining costs, which include workforce and maintenance, also play a role, as does government regulations and taxes.

    li The cost of gasoline can vary significantly from state to state due to differences in tax rates. |li Government regulations on fuel production and distribution can impact prices at the pump. |li Consumer demand, seasonal factors, and holidays can all influence gas prices.

Moreover, fluctuating currency values can affect the cost of imported crude oil, adding another layer to the complexity.

From Crude Oil to Car Engine: The Petrol Production Process

The journey of petrol, from rough oil deep underground to the fuel powering your vehicle, is a fascinating transformation. It all begins with extraction crude oil through drilling rigs. This heavy liquid is then shipped to refineries, where it undergoes a series of complex chemical processes. First, the crude oil is separated into different components based on their boiling points. Next, these fractions are refined to remove impurities and create various petroleum materials, including gasoline.

The purified gasoline is then blended with additives to enhance its performance and reliability. Finally, the finished petrol is distributed to gas stations, ready to be burned in car engines, providing the energy needed for transportation.
